Properties: The Pitt was initially the result of the atomization of land, air, property and organisms within a 25' mile spherical radius centered 10 miles above the city of Pittsburgh.

    All of the atomized matter, as well as the residual energies following the Star Brand massive release, settled into the bottom of the resultant Pitt, although dark clouds and atomized airborn debris obscurred vistualization of the Pitt.

    The edges of the Pitt were initially smooth, like polished glass, fused by the unleashed energies.

    Massive amounts of water from rivers entering into the region swiftly poured into the Pitt, and -- due to rupture of tectonic plates, a large volcano soon after pushed up from the middle of the Pitt.

    The contents of the Pitt were impregnated with Star Brand energies and the combined materials of everything atomized.

    Material known as "Pitt Juice," within the fluid at its bottom and periodically erupting from solid material like geysers, tended to have mutagenic effects on the people and animals exposed to them.

    Animals and/or people were mutated into monstrous and often savage forms, some people gained superhuman forms and abilities, and some paranormals were further affected by "Pitt Juice" exposure.

    The volcano periodically spewed magma, molten rock, which poured down its edges via gravity and threatened to incinerate anyone or anything it touched.

    The volcanic eruption and the magma it spewed progressively decreased the depth of the Pitt.

    The region between the edges of the Pitt and the volcano came to be known as the Ditch.

History:

.

pitt-148611-pittsburgh-connellpitt-148611-pittsburgh-transfer(Justice#18 (fb) - BTS) <December 21, 1987>- Glen Baker, a paranormal able to see up to 48 hours in the future and living in the relative vicinity of Pittsburgh, foresaw the "Justice Killer" (John Tensen) coming for him.

      That evening, Baker saw what he believed to be the end of the world, after which his hair turned white. However, confident that no one would believe him, Baker apparently told no one.

(Marvel Graphic Novel: The Pitt#1) <December 22, 1987 4:10 PM EST> - Nelson Kohler, aka the Witness, a phantasmal being who sensed paranormal manifestations and who was somewhere in Pittsburgh at the time, felt agony and was drawn toward Pittsburgh.

(The Star Brand#12 - BTS) - Seeking to rid himself of the Star Brand, Ken Connell took his friend Myron Feldman's advice to transfer the energies into an inanimate object.

    Both men were aware that the being known as the Old Man had previously attempted to transfer the Star Brand power into an asteroid, and that the energies released had resulted in the "White Event," which had empowered their Earth's paranormals.

    They were also aware that 90% of the power could be expelled thusly and that Ken could exhaust his remaining 10% protecting himself from the energy release.

    Myron gave Ken a dumbbell and advised him to fly to the dark side of the moon to ensure that no one would be affected by the energies the transfer would unleash.

    Fearing being left helpless on the moon and wanting be able to get to a hospital quickly if needed, Connell instead flew 10 miles into the air.

(The Star Brand#12 / Marvel Graphic Novel: The Pitt#1) <December 22, 1987 6:06 PM EST (see comments)> - - Concentrating his powers to focus and contain the blast, Connell initiated the transfer, and the resultant energies unleashed "vaporized" (or perhaps atomized) everything (except Connell himself) within a 25 mile radius (see comments) in all directions, including the upper atmosphere/ozone layer).

(Marvel Graphic Novel: The Pitt#1) - Kohler witnessed as Connell's form was carried away, while everything and everyone in the region surrounding the vaporized region was pulled toward the point of origin to replace the resultant vacuum.

pitt-148611-pittsburgh-pitt-initial(Marvel Graphic Novel: The Pitt#1 (fb) - BTS) - Over a million people perished in the blast, and hundreds of towns and villages were destroyed.

    Tectonic plates were ruptured, and a hotbed of volcanic activity was left behind.

    The waters of the Monongahela and Allegheny rivers poured into the crater in a spectacular waterfall, combining with the seemingly inert material left behind from the destroyed matter and the Star Brand energy).

(Marvel Graphic Novel: The Pitt#1 (fb) - BTS) -  <6:08 PM> - 26 miles away from the destroyed region, the car transporting Janey, Leonard, Marge & Timmy Robinson (confirm last name) was pulled into the Pitt, arriving 8 minutes later.

(Justice#18 - BTS) - Having sensed Glen Baker's power and his having used it only for personal gain, Justice confronted him and stated his purpose. Unconcerned, Baker related his recent visions. Tensen told Baker that if he had truly foreseen armageddon, he could make sure Baker was not there for it. Baker told Justice he did not think Justice would have the time, and immediately afterward they saw and felt the effects of the destruction (see comments)

(Justice#18 - BTS) - A nearby dog was killed by the sound of the implosion, and Justice tried to catch a young girl who was pulled through the air by force of the air rushing to fill the vacuum, but the girl's coat ripped, and she continued to fly toward the source of the vacuum. Meanwhile, Baker wrapped the chains from a swingset around his neck, allowing the force at which he was subsequently pulled to break his neck, apparently killing him.

     <6:17 PM> - As those at the Griffis Air Force Base in New York registered that Pittsburgh had been turned into a crater, 50 miles across, Henderson contacted the Chief of Staff.

    <6:51 PM> - Soldiers brought Col. MacIntrye Browning -- who had felt the vibration four minutes earlier -- from Washington, D.C., to lead the investigation.

    <9:01 PM> - Browning's jet (aka "Close-Up") arrived over the site and found no one from Pittsburgh within radio signal.

    After a few passes to investigate the vapor-covered crater, he contacted "Tin Lizzie," instructing Jenny Swenson to use her MAX suit to investigate as Spitfire.

(Justice#18 - BTS) - Having kept himself on the ground with a force field, Justice released it to catch an infant in a carseat, after which he formed a field around the two of them as they were pulled toward the source of the vacuum.

    After what seemed like hours, the force of the wind faded, and they crashed to the ground.

(Justice#18 (fb) - BTS) - Justice and the baby were found by local senior couple Willie and Edna, who brought them back to their house, 30 miles east of Pittsburgh. They called the police, who were too busy to respond/investigate.

    <10:02 PM - 2:00 AM, December 23> - Kohler investigated the crater, at the bottom seemingly encountering the ghosts of those who died in the destruction; he subsequently resolved that this had been a delusion caused by his difficulty in processing the mass destruction.pitt-148611-pittsburgh-pitt-smoking crater

    <10:11 PM> - 15 miles from the edge of the crater, MacIntyre had the field soldiers establish a perimeter, with only security G-7 passing beyond that point; with this unprecedented event, MacIntyre disregarded the lack of martial law, ordering the shooting of any trying to pass that point.

    <11:02 PM> - Spitfire flew the 15 miles to the depth of the crater, recording her findings and saving the Robinson family from beneath the water covering the bottom, although both she and they were exposed to the material later referred to as Pitt juice (the Star Brand energy-infused residue from the destruction).

    They reached the surface at 1:04 AM.

    <December 23, 1:29 - 1:43 AM> - Swenson related her findings to MacIntrye, and he ordered the base camp to be sealed up tightly, with no signals going in or out unless they were through him. After MacIntyre contacted the Air Force base in Cheyenne Mountain, he was given authority "you can take this as from the commander-in-chief...you have maxium authority in this. Do anything you deem necessary to keep that area sealed."

    When Smitty and his reporter associate flew a helicopter over the crater, they repeatedly refused commands to follow them back to a holding area. Ultimately, Browning authorized the helicopter to be shot down, which it was.

    <3:18 AM> - After Swenson showed MacIntyre her MAX armor's analysis of the entire zone of destruction, he instructed her to return to the crater to gather more data. When she suggested that everything within the crater was dead and that she could save lives by exploring the perimeter, he forbade it, resulting in her departing with her armor.

    <4:21 AM> - Spitfire observed Kohler within the crater, but he sank below the water to avoid her. Kohler resolved to find Connell (not that he knew his name) and make him pay in order to avenge Pittsburgh.

    <4:57 AM> - Having discovered the existence of the Pittsburgh crater, Soviet authorities sent word to US news programs, who reported the information over their television network.

    <Shortly after 6:06 AM> - Col. Browning wrote his report, referring to the event as the "Pittsburgh Effect" and the resultant site as the "Pitt" (to which he had heard it ghoulishly referred). He speculated that the "super hero" who had showed up in Pittsburgh as likely involved.

(The Star Brand#15 (fb) - BTS) - The energies generated by the vaporization of massive amounts of matter by the energies of the Star Brand that created the Pitt also mutated some of the plant life immediately surrounding the Pitt...or perhaps the plant life developed within the resultant "Pitt Juice" that formed from the vaporized matter and energies (that was greatly expanded in volume but diluted by the water of the
Monongahela and Allegheny rivers that poured into it) and then escaped as volcanic pressure broke through the bottom fused surface of the Pitt.

(The Star Brand#15) -
A pair of soldiers in "Sector 58" encountered a biped mutate. As it approached them, they prepared to blow it up with some sort of shoulder-cannon-weapon. However, the ground shook, preventing proper aiming, and then a number of plant tendrils erupted through the ground, presumably killing both men.

     Their (presumably death) screams were transmitted back to the nearby military base, which was under the direction of Colonel Browning, who ordered that no one was to enter or leave the base and that outside communication was strictly prohibited.

    Sensing something alive and in pain, the Starchild traveled to and investigated the Pitt. He flew through the cloud cover and into the pit, approaching the "Pitt-juice" and noting that the material had been originally unique on Earth and perhaps in the universe, but that for months it had been diluted by waters flowing into the crater, which made it difficult for the Starchild to isolate the source of the life-energy he detected. Feeling the energy to be all around him, the Starchild risked going below the surface of the Pitt-Juice, appreciating that even his own power may not be able to resist the forces that lurked below.

    Using enhanced perceptions to observe his surroundings, the Starchild appreciated that everything that had been pulled into the Pitt -- from the corpses of people and animals to automobiles and various other objects -- had been perfectly preservd within the Pitt-Juice. Finally, at the bottom of the Pitt, the Starchild observed fissures in the fused edges of the Pitt wall (caused by the volcanic pressure building beneath it) through which emerged the plant tendrils.

    Just above the surface of the edge, a doctor aboard the helicopter carrying Colonel
MacIntrye Browning noted that everything within 3' of the Pitt was alive, a single gigantic life form. The doctor further added that the organism was spreading at an average of about a mile a day...in some place not at all, but in other places, it was spreading like wildfire. Browning had the pilot assault the Pitt creature, but it recovered, grabbed the helicopter and pulled it down.

    As portions of the plant creature assaulted a town reportedly 100 miles from the Pitt, the Starchild confronted it and used the Star Brand power to force the creature to retreat back to the Pitt. At the Pitt's edge, the creature resisted, and when the Starchild attempted to force the creature back within the Pitt, the creature perished.

pitt-148611-pittsburgh-sizecalculationPitt size:

  • The blast that created the Pitt was supposed to have created a hole 15 miles deep and to have vaporized everything within 25 miles of Ken Connell's energy release, which makes sense as he had flown 10 miles into the air prior to his...mishap.
  • They also note that the crater on Earth was 50 miles wide, which seems to make sense, but at 10 miles below its center, the sphere is not going to be 50 miles across...
    • specifically, courtesy of Mathematics teacher Loki, the diameter of the crater based on the above information would be just over 45.8 miles across.
  • Perhaps the force of the sudden vacuum, etc. caused the edges of the crater to crumble and collapse, swiftly expanding to swiftly reach that 50-mile distance?
  • Or, perhaps, Connell's efforts to contain the energies distorted the field into more of an ellipse than a sphere?
  • Browning's report did note that the radius of destruction, including earth and atmosphere was 50 miles, so perhaps that was the most accurate, and the other reports were early estimates that could have been rounded up?
  • The inside front cover to D.P. 7#19 notes the Pitt to be a 25 mile mide crater surrounded by 15 miles of debris.
